- Test drive vehicles to assess the work done and for diagnosis of issues customers bring vehicles in for.
- Move frequently (walking/ climbing stairs) between the Workshop, Service Advisors and Parts department in order to generate quotes for repairs.
- Discuss repair orders with service advisors and customers as required and provide coherent explanations.
- Provide accurate diagnosis in order for estimates (cost, time, effort) for repairs to be correct.
- Carry out allocated maintenance, repair and diagnostic work as instructed. Working in a standing position with a vehicle overhead on a hoist or working in a bent position with a vehicle in a repair bay.
- Performing tasks such as replacing oil or lubricating equipment; inspecting, replacing and/or repairing damaged and malfunctioning parts. Repairs can include removal and refitment of a gearbox or engine, or removal and refitment of wheels when brakes need to be replaced.
- Use diagnostic equipment correctly for vehicle diagnosis and repair.
- Perform all duties in line with OEM and warranty requirements.
- Ensure diagnosis leads to most cost-effective and accurate remedy to fault or customer complaint.
- Take steps to ensure service and maintenance of vehicles remains within the targeted percentages of the manufacturers' time.
- Ensure vehicles are returned to the customer after service/ repair in a neat, clean and safe condition.
- Produce legible and accurate paperwork, job cards etc reflecting the work performed.
- Provide advice and support to other mechanics on technical matters.
- Ensure effective communication with staff, across departments, with customers and service providers.
- Maintain a clean, safe working environment.
- Successfully and timeously complete all required OEM and other training considered relevant.
- Qualified as Automotive Master Technician is a minimum requirement.
- 3+ years’ experience as a qualified technician – highly desired.
- Valid, unendorsed driver’s license and safe driving record.
- Capable of performing the physical requirements/ demands and stamina associated with the role such as frequently handling heavy equipment & machinery; using their hands to handle, control, or feel objects, tools, or controls; standing for long periods of time; bending or twisting the body; repetition of movements; kneeling, stooping, crouching, working in confined spaces to inspect, test and repair vehicle components.
- Competent at operating manufacturer diagnostic equipment in order to access information required to perform the role and complete duties associated with the role.

About Motus Corporation
Motus is a multi-national provider of automotive mobility solutions and vehicle products and services, delivering 77 years of steady growth and reliable value creation. Our leading market presence in South Africa is enhanced by selected international offerings in the United Kingdom, Australia, Asia and Southern and East Africa.
Motus employs over 20 000 people globally and is a diversified (non-manufacturing) business in the automotive sector. Motus is South Africa’s leading automotive group, with unrivalled scale and scope across the automotive value chain.
Motus offers a differentiated value proposition to OEMs, customers and business partners with a business model that integrates our four business segments: Import and Distribution, Retail and Rental, Mobility Solutions and Aftermarket Parts, providing multiple customer touchpoints that support resilience and meet customers’ mobility needs across the vehicle ownership cycle.
Motus has long-standing importer, distribution and retail partnerships with leading OEMs, representing some of the world’s most recognisable brands. We provide automotive manufacturers with a highly effective route-to-market and a vital link between the brand and the customer throughout the vehicle’s lifecycle. In addition, we provide accessories and aftermarket automotive parts for out-of-warranty vehicles and the Mobility Solutions segment sells value-added products and services to customers, including non-insurance and insurance products, consumer mobility solutions, and fleet services.
